Friend, Enabler and Comrade: Remembering Donna Lynas (1967–2021)


Friend, Enabler and Comrade: Remembering Donna Lynas (1967–2021)
Tributes to the late director of Wysing Art Centre, who supported a generation of artists in the UK
As the Director of Wysing Art Centre since 2005, Donna Lynas built one of the UK’s most dynamic residency programmes. She transformed the site, in rural Cambridgeshire, into a place where artists across disciplines and at all stages of their careers can research, experiment, collaborate and learn. As Chair of the Contemporary Visual Arts Network East and member of the Plus Tate steering committee, she built connections with arts organizations across the country as well as internationally; she was a particularly vocal and energetic supporter of art scenes in the South East. In recognition of her work, Lynas was awarded an MBE in the 2020 Queen’s Birthday Honours, for Services to the Arts. It is not a stretch to say that she touched a whole generation of artists in the UK. She will be missed.

Firstsite's The Great Big Art Exhibition invites the UK public to get creative


Firstsite's The Great Big Art Exhibition invites the UK public to get creative
Running until the end of April, the UK is encouraged to draw, sculpt and paint to themes set fortnightly by artists such as Antony Gormley, Anish Kapoor, Jeremy Deller, David Shrigley and Ai Weiwei.

With more time on our hands now is a perfect time to get creative, something that The Great Big Art Exhibition – launched on 28 January – aims to inspire. People across the UK are invited to take part in a collaborative exhibition that sees the nation encouraged to draw, sculpt, paint and build their own piece of art and to stick up on their window, or any part of their house for that matter. Running until April 2021, a selection of renowned artists are set to choose a different theme each fortnight. First, it’s Antony Gormley who’s opened the show with a theme of animals. Sonia Boyce is following with a theme of portraits, while other artists include Etel Adnan and Simone Fattal, Anish Kapoor, Tai Shan, Jeremy Deller, David Shrigley, Ai Weiwei and Ryan Gander.

The iconic Trump baby balloon has been acquired by the Museum of London ahead of Joe Biden’s inauguration tomorrow. (20th January). The Museum has recognised its significance in the protests that took place in London in July 2018 and June 2019 when protesters took to the streets on President Trump’s visits to the UK. Trump’s reaction was; “They Love Me In England.”
The Trump Baby can now be consigned to history along with the man himself
The over-sized balloon toured the world and now will be conserved and displayed in the Museum’s future new home in West Smithfield in the coming years.

The Secretary of State has reappointed Sir Nicholas Serota as Chair of Arts Council England.

Sir Nicholas Serota has been reappointed by the Secretary of State for Digital, Culture, Media and Sport as Chair of Arts Council England for four years from 01 February 2021 to 31 January 2025.
